Shiloh's Story
"When I was seven, on what was supposed to be a fun day with my best friend on Halloween, I had my first seizure while eating fries. I think the only good thing is that I didn’t get hurt and she didn’t get scared cause her parents were able to explain what had just happened to me. Unfortunately, by my second seizure which I had in school, I scared a lot of my friends and they no longer wanted to play or talk to me. They said I was contagious..." See More
